Vince Vaughn has a thing for the ladies, young and old. The New York Daily News reports the Swingers stud rushed to the aid of an elderly woman recently while filming his new mob comedy Made. The paper says Vaughn was shooting a fight scene with Jon Favreau and Jennifer Esposito on the streets of New York when he saw the woman, a pedestrian, trip over a production cable. Vaughn broke character and ran over to help the woman. He even bandaged her wound and escorted her into an ambulance. The News says that the medical personnel also tried to help the actor after confusing his fake blood for the real thing.

HOLLYWOOD (Variety) - "Swingers'' duo Jon Favreau and Vince Vaughn will next spring reunite for the first time since that 1996 cult hit when they star in and produce a gangster flick.
"Made'' tells the story of two wanna-be Los Angeles mobsters who work as club boxers and construction workers. The pair is sent to New York in a comic and dramatic attempt to become "made'' men. Artisan Entertainment has acquired worldwide rights to the film.
"The chemistry between John and Vince onscreen and off is incredible,'' said Artisan president Bill Block. "'Swingers' was such a critical favorite and when 'Made' came to us we acted quickly to bring this film into the Artisan fold.''
Favreau and Vaughn had intended to work together on Favreau's "Guam Goes to The Moon'' at Paramount, but the duo has fallen off that project.
Vaughn can next be seen starring opposite Jennifer Lopez in New Line's "The Cell.'' Favreau stars opposite Famke Janssen ("GoldenEye'') in "Love and Sex,'' which debuts at Sundance.

Variety August 25, 1999. Ed Harris is in talks to join Vince Vaughn in Gregory Mosher's "The Prime Gig" for Cary Woods' Independent Pictures. Pic is about a young telemarketer (Vaughn) who goes to work for a polished con man. A plan to steal an elderly woman's life savings causes the telemarketer to rethink things.

April 29, 1998--Sporting a very shaved head [not quite bald], Vince had an all-too-brief interview with Rosie, who spent entirely too much time with Maria Carey and some kid who could recite all the Presidents & party affiliations [whoo-wee!].Vince told Rosie that he was named Vince because his mom liked the "double V" thing - his dad is Vernon. Therefore, the kids were Vince, Valerie, and Victoria. Pretty cool tidbit I had never heard!Vince showed a clip of his movie, Return to Paradise, with Anne Heche, due out in August. The film also stars Joaquin Phoenix and Jada Pinkett. While filming in Thailand, Vince got sick at McDonald's - he said it was probably the "special sauce."Vince told Rosie about doing musical theater as a kid. As an 8-year-old, he played Daddy Warbucks in Annie, opposite a 12-year-old Annie. Vince said he was the worst singer and had to "Yul Brynner" his was through the songs [i.e. basically speak his lyrics].

The Larry Sanders Show, April 12, 1998 [HBO]: Vince Vaughn plays himself on the newest episode of Larry Sanders. Hank [Jefferey Tambor] and Vince get into a little playful kidding while on-air that Hank didn't think was nearly as funny off-air. So, when Hank's Bentley gets hit in the parking garage, he's convinced it's Vince Vaughn. Funny episode but aren't they all?!
